117.info
人生若只如初见

c# sqlhelper适用哪些开发场景

C# SQLHelper 是一个用于简化数据库操作的类库,适用于以下开发场景:

  1. Web 应用程序:在ASP.NET Web应用程序中,可以使用SQLHelper来执行CRUD(创建、读取、更新和删除)操作,从而简化数据访问层。

  2. Windows 桌面应用程序:在Windows Forms或WPF应用程序中,可以使用SQLHelper来执行数据库操作,以便在本地或远程数据库中存储和检索数据。

  3. 控制台应用程序:在C#控制台应用程序中,可以使用SQLHelper来执行数据库操作,以便在文件中或数据库中存储和检索数据。

  4. 服务和微服务:在基于ASP.NET Core的Web应用程序、API或微服务中,可以使用SQLHelper来执行数据库操作,以便在数据库中存储和检索数据。

  5. 数据访问层:在分层架构中,可以使用SQLHelper作为数据访问层的一部分,以便将数据库操作与其他业务逻辑分离。

  6. 数据迁移和脚本执行:使用SQLHelper可以执行数据库迁移脚本,以便在数据库结构发生变化时更新数据库架构。

  7. 数据分析和报告:使用SQLHelper可以从数据库中检索数据,以便进行数据分析和报告生成。

总之,C# SQLHelper 适用于需要执行数据库操作的C#应用程序,可以帮助开发者简化数据库操作,提高代码的可读性和可维护性。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e5bfAzsICQZWAw.html

推荐文章

  • c++中extern c的用法是什么

    在C++中,使用extern "C"关键字可以告诉编译器将函数的名字按照C语言的方式进行编译。这在C++中主要用于解决C++代码与C代码进行混编时的一些问题。
    具体来说...

  • C#枚举使用的方法是什么

    在C#中,枚举可以通过以下方式定义和使用: 定义枚举类型: enum DaysOfWeek
    { Monday, Tuesday, Wednesday, Thursday, Friday, Saturday, Sunday
    } 使...

  • c++中greater的作用有哪些

    在C++中,greater函数对象可用于比较两个值的大小,它通常用作STL中的排序函数或容器的比较函数。具体作用如下: 在STL中的sort函数中可以使用greater函数对象进...

  • c++中greater的用法是什么

    在C++中,greater是一个函数对象,用于比较两个值的大小并返回一个布尔值。它通常用作STL算法中的比较函数,如std::sort和std::max_element等。
    greater函数...

  • c# sqlhelper怎样简化数据操作

    在C#中,使用SQLHelper类可以简化数据库操作。SQLHelper是一个用于执行SQL语句并返回结果集的辅助类。它通常包含以下功能: 连接数据库
    执行SQL查询
    执...

  • c# sqlhelper如何防止sql注入

    在C#中,使用SQLHelper类来防止SQL注入的关键是使用参数化查询。参数化查询是一种将查询和数据分开的方法,它可以确保用户输入的数据不会被解释为SQL代码的一部分...

  • c# sqlhelper能连接多数据库吗

    是的,C# SQLHelper 可以连接多个数据库。要实现这个功能,您需要为每个数据库创建一个单独的连接字符串,并在创建 SqlHelper 实例时使用相应的连接字符串。以下...

  • c# sqlhelper怎样处理事务

    在C#中,使用SqlHelper类处理事务通常涉及以下步骤: 创建一个SqlHelper实例:首先,需要创建一个SqlHelper实例,该实例将用于执行SQL命令和事务操作。 SqlHelpe...